Water, Trails and the Centre of Gualba
The Passeig Montseny crosses the town centre for approximately 600 metres. Its first section, lined with plane trees, leads to the centre of Gualba and forms the town’s central axis. On the outskirts of Gualba, the Itinerari de patrimoni i entorn also runs as a walking route in which the Riera and its promenade are central elements.

Churches and Visible History
Sant Vicenç de Gualba is the parish church in the centre of Gualba de Dalt. Its façade and apse area preserve important elements of the building’s 11th-century appearance. The former chapel of Sant Cristòfol is also part of the local history: it can be traced back to 1328 and was rebuilt in 1587. The two religious buildings add distinct historical perspectives to the town.
Festivals Between Tradition and Programme
The Fira de Gualba, Vall de Fetilleres, is an established summer festival in Gualba. The programme includes a craft market, street performances, live music, theatre, workshops and family activities. In Gualba, the traditional Sant Joan bonfire is also lit in the square in the evening after dark. At one edition of the Fira de Bruixes de Gualba, stalls offering crafts as well as esoteric and gastronomic products, tarot, talks, exhibitions and the theatre performance “El retorn de les Bruixes” were presented along the Passeig del Montseny and at Plaça Joan Ragué.
